We find that at subgap voltages, eV<2Delta/n, the current associated with the chain of n Andreev reflections is mapped onto the quasiparticle flow through a structure of n+1 voltage biased barriers connected by diffusive conductors. As a result, the current-voltage characteristic of a long SNINS structure obeys Ohm's law, in spite of the complex multiparticle transport process.
